The term “track and trace” is used to describe a set of interconnected software that is able to determine the current or past location of a shipment, asset or temperature trail. The data is then analysed to help ensure safety, quality and compliance with the laws and regulations. This technology can also increase logistics efficiency by reducing unneeded inventory and identifying possible bottlenecks.

Currently track and trace is utilized by the majority of companies for internal processes. However, it is becoming more popular to apply it to the orders of customers. This is due to the fact that many customers expect a speedy and reliable delivery service. Additionally the tracking and tracing process can result in better customer service and increased sales.

To reduce the risk of injury to workers, utilities have incorporated track and trace technology in their power tool fleets. The tools that are smart in these systems are able to detect when they’re misused and shut off themselves to avoid injury. They also monitor and report on the force needed to tighten the screw.

In other situations, track-and trace is used to verify the qualifications of a worker to perform an exact task. For instance, if an employee of a utility is installing a pipe, they must be certified for the task. A Track and Trace System can scan an ID badge and check it against the utility’s Operator Qualification Database to confirm that the right people are carrying out the proper tasks at the appropriate time.

Anticounterfeiting

Counterfeiting has become a significant issue for consumers, 프라그마틱 무료게임please click the following internet page – businesses and governments across the world. The scale and complexity of the issue has increased with the rise of globalization since counterfeiters operate in multiple countries with different laws or languages, as well as time zones. This makes it difficult to trace and track their activities. Counterfeiting is a serious issue that can damage the economy, hurt the reputation of brands and even affect human health.

The global market for anti-counterfeiting technology, authentication and verification is expected to expand by 11.8% CAGR from 2018 to 2023. This is due to the growing demand for products with enhanced security features. This technology is also used to monitor supply chains and protect intellectual property rights. It also shields against unfair competition and online squatting. Combating counterfeiting requires cooperation from people around the globe.

Counterfeiters can market their fake products by mimicking authentic products using a low-cost production process. They can employ various methods and tools, including holograms, QR codes, and RFID tags, to make their products appear genuine. They also create websites and social media accounts to promote their products. Anticounterfeiting technology is crucial for both consumer and business safety.

Some fake products can be dangerous to the health of consumers, while others cause financial losses to businesses. Product recalls, lost revenue, fraudulent warranty claims and overproduction costs are all examples of the harm caused by counterfeiting. A company that is impacted by counterfeiting may be unable to restore the trust and loyalty of customers. The quality of counterfeit products is also low, which can damage the image and reputation of the business.

A new anticounterfeiting technique can help businesses defend their products from counterfeiters by using 3D printed security features. University of Maryland chemical and biomolecular engineering Ph.D. student Po-Yen Chen collaborated with colleagues from Anhui University of Technology and Qian Xie to develop this new method of safeguarding goods from counterfeits. The research of the team relies on an 2D material tag and an AI-enabled software to verify the authenticity of products.

Authentication

Authentication is a crucial aspect of security that validates the identity and credentials of the user. It is not the same as authorization, 프라그마틱 슈가러쉬 which decides which files or tasks a user can access. Authentication checks credentials against existing identities to verify access. Hackers can bypass it however it is a vital component of any security system. Utilizing the most secure authentication methods can make it harder for fraudsters to make a profit of your business.

There are several types of authentication, ranging from biometrics to password-based authentication to voice recognition. Password-based authentication is the most commonly used type of authentication, and it requires the user to enter a password that matches their stored password exactly. The system will reject passwords that don’t match. Hackers can easily guess weak passwords. It’s therefore important to choose passwords that are strong and contain at minimum 10 characters long. Biometrics are a more sophisticated form of authentication. They include fingerprint scans, retinal pattern scans, and facial recognition. These methods are very difficult to copy or fake by a hacker, and they are considered to be the most secure authentication method.

Security

The most important aspect of any digital object is that it must be secure against malicious manipulation or accidental corruption. This is accomplished through the combination of authenticity and non-repudiation. Authenticity verifies an object’s identity (by internal metadata), while non-repudiation shows that the object was not altered after it was sent.

While traditional methods for establishing authenticity of a piece of art require identifying deceit or malice the process of checking integrity is more precise and less intrusive. Integrity is established by comparing the artifact with a rigorously vetted and precisely identified original version. This method is not without its limitations however, especially in an environment where the integrity of an object can be weakened by a variety of elements that are not related to malice or fraud.

Through a quantitative study in combination with expert interviews This research examines methods for verifying the authenticity of luxury items. The results reveal that both experts and consumers recognize a number of flaws in the authentication methods currently used to authenticate these high-value products. The most well-known weaknesses are a high cost for authentication of products and a low trust that the available methods work correctly.

Additionally, it has been shown that the most desired features for product verification by consumers are an authentic authentication certificate that is reliable and a uniform authentication process. Moreover, the results suggest that both experts as well as consumers want an improvement in the authentication of luxury goods. It is clear that counterfeiting costs companies trillions of dollars every year and poses a serious threat to the health of consumers. The development of effective methods for the authentication of luxury products is therefore an important research area.
